House Estermont of Greenstone is a noble house from the Stormlands, ruling the small island of Estermont south of the Shipbreaker Bay.
Their arms depict a dark green sea turtle on pale green.[1][2] Their motto is unknown.
Contents
The Estermont House at the end of the third century
The known Estermonts during the timespan of the events described on A Song of Ice and Fire are:
- Lord Eldon Estermont, Lord of Greenstone. An ancient man. Old-fashioned and cautious.
- Ser Aemon Estermont, Eldon's eldest son and heir.
- Ser Alyn Estermont, Aemon's son.
- Ser Lomas Estermont, his second son.
- Ser Andrew Estermont, Lomas' son.
- {Cassana Estermont}, his niece. Deceased in a shipwreck with her husband, Lord Steffon Baratheon.
- {Robert I}, her eldest son. Slain by a boar.
- Stannis I, her second son. Claimant to the Iron Throne.
- {Renly I}, her third son. Slain under mysterious circumstances.

References in the books
The Hedge Knight
- Dunk spots the Estermont turtle among the heraldry present at the Ashford Tourney. Ser Gunthor Estermont rides in the lists.
A Song of Ice and Fire
- Cersei Lannister remembers how Robert spent half a year at Estermont with his mother's family. There he bedded a cousin he used to play with as a child.
- Stannis Baratheon starts his letter proclaiming himself King stating that all men know him as the trueborn son of Steffon Baratheon and by his wife Cassana Estermont.
- On the outset of the War of the Five Kings, Lord Eldon declared for his nephew and liege, King Renly Baratheon. The Estermonts' sea turtle is seen by Catelyn Tully in Renly's camp.
- The day before his death, when he was preparing the battle against his brother Stannis, Renly decided Lord Estermont would command the reserve of his army. Lord Estermont assured him he would not fail.
- The Estermonts turn to Stannis after Renly's death, along with most other stormlords.
- Ser Cortnay Penrose acknowledged the presence the great lords Estermont, Errol and Varner during his parley with Stannis.
- Lord Estermont recommended against storming the walls of Storm's End, believing it would cost too many lives. He suggested a duel against Ser Cortnay, or a long siege to starve them.
- Lord Estermont refused to turn to the religion of the Lord of Light, and asked to fight under the crowned stag banner instead of the flaming heart.
- The banner of House Estermont was spotted in the van of Stannis's army as it approached King's Landing.
- Lord Estermont and his men fought at the Battle of the Blackwater. Along with his first son Ser Aemon and his grandson Ser Alyn, Lord Eldon is made a prisoner and bends the knee to Joffrey after Stannis' defeat.
- Lord Estermont's second son Ser Lomas and his grandson Ser Andrew escape the battle, and lead part of the Greenstone men in remaining loyal to Stannis after the Blackwater.
- Lord Estermont was a guest at Joffrey's wedding.
- Ser Andrew Estermont helped Davos Seaworth to smuggle Edric Storm out of Dragonstone. He sailed away with the boy, commanding his escort.
- Lord Estermont declared at Tyrion Lannister's trial that he had seen how Tyrion picked up the chalice as Joffrey was dying and poured the remaining wine to the floor.
- The Estermont banner was seen at Castle Black after Stannis's arrival.
- Old Lord Estermont was one of the insulting matches Lord Doran Martell proposed to his daughter Arianne.
- Lord Qyburn reports to Cersei that Lord Eldon Estermont married Sylva Santagar - unknown to those in King's Landing, this was punishment for Sylva's part in Arianne Martell's attempted coup.
